When the temperature got into the teens, I ventured out for a short walk at Denison as I was definitely getting a bit stir crazy having stayed in given the bitter cold. V little at Denison but I did see a Hermit Thrush that showed well and was making its call note. Needed that for January.
Then I did a drive through the Tagg Rd area hoping for at least a Horned Lark. No larks or longspurs but saw 4 Am Pipits which was nice and a N Harrier as well. So, 3 more for my anemic January list today.
Nothing unusual at my feeders has shown up.
